WebAbstract The moving sofa problem, posed by L. Moser in 1966, asks for the planar shape of maximal area that can move around a right-angled corner in a hallway of unit width, and is conjectured to have as its solution a complicated shape derived by Gerver in 1992. WebJan 17, 2024 · In mathematics, this problem is known as the Moving Sofa Problem, and it is unsolved. If we look at a hallway with a 90-degree turn and legs of width 1 m (i.e. h = 1 above), the largest known sofa that can make the turn is Gerver’s Sofa which has an area of 2.2195 m2, this area is known as the Sofa Constant.
